Story summary
- Oklahoma's Broadband Office targets 95% internet access by 2028 and aims to exceed by next year.
- Oklahoma shifts from fiber to fixed wireless and satellite to cut costs, risking service quality.
- The BEAD program has allocated $42 billion for broadband. Oklahoma's funding is now $550 million, down from $797 million, pending guidance from the National Telecommunications and Information Administration (NTIA).
